0

js sdk を使用して、fb ページを公開および編集します。これは、昨日、ユーザーが FB でアプリをアンインストールしたときに作成中のページ エディターで何が起こるかをテストし始めるまで、正常に機能していました。

エディターでページをリロードすると、js ログイン ボックスが表示され、アプリを再度承認する必要があるため、正常に機能しているように見えました。しかし、FB ページを公開または更新しようとすると、これらのエラーが発生し続けました。

code 300    
message "(#300) Edit failure"
type "OAuthException"

面白いことに、ページは公開され、更新は fB 自体にも公開されます。したがって、ページの公開と更新は正常に機能しますが、スクリプトを台無しにするこのエラーも発生します。

FB.api('/'+pageTabId+'?access_token='+pageAccessToken, 'post', params, function(response) {
    if (!response || response.error) { //
        console.log("Error Installing:");
     } else {
        console.log('tab updated');                                                                                          
     }          
});

FB からログアウトし、アプリをアンインストールし、すべての Cookie とキャッシュを削除しようとしました。しかし、どれも違いを生むようには見えません.. 以前はこれを持っていましたが、突然消えました. しかし、今回はそうではないようです。

「OAuthException」は、私が変更を行う権限がないことを示していますが、私が行った変更またはページ自体が公開される可能性はありますか?

(#300) Edit failure エラーが表示されないようにするにはどうすればよいですか?

4

1 に答える 1

0

参考までに、このFBバグレポートに出くわしましたhttps://developers.facebook.com/bugs/255313014574414/

于 2013-05-23T20:01:07.383 に答える